6. Supported more than that
"He applauded the efforts of Senate Budget Committee chairman Pete Domenici, R-Nev., who presented his own balanced budget plan last week… Dean also said he could defend Domenici's approach to reducing Medicare costs. He said he supported more managed care for Medicare recipients and requiring some Medicare recipients to pay a greater share of the cost of their medical services…
'I fully subscribe to the notion that we should reduce the Medicare growth rate from 10 percent to 7 percent, or less if possible,' Dean said.'" Times Argus '95

So while he is proposing this 'great' health care plan now, back then he thought reducing coverage to senior citizens was a good idea. He's not somebody to trust on health care.
